Subject: [PATCH v1 19/29] virito-mem: existing (un)plug functions are specific to Sub Block Mode (SBM)
Date: Mon, 12 Oct 2020 14:53:13 +0200	[thread overview]
Message-ID: <20201012125323.17509-20-david@redhat.com> (raw)
In-Reply-To: <20201012125323.17509-1-david@redhat.com>

Let's rename them accordingly. virtio_mem_plug_request() and
virtio_mem_unplug_request() will be handled separately.
